Output 81531c68b51435c7697896e7dd37a0f7496357335da7815688ec7e6819cd362b:0

value
21563852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 389cc4b7aeef54c8a8e5f062aa0731b0323f88ca OP_EQUAL
address
36rMZkK6zyQXHZMri5FH8yLrAJY4PjBSr9
transaction
81531c68b51435c7697896e7dd37a0f7496357335da7815688ec7e6819cd362b
confirmations
529356
spent
true